Richwood in color

By By Kyle Meddles, Richwood Gazette 

The Richwood Bank held a ribbon-cutting for the village’s mural on June 26, located at 24 E. Blagrove St. Above, Richwood’s historian Charles “Chuck” Barry stands next to his likeness after providing photos to use as templates for the many historical buildings depicted. Below, the Richwood mural committee poses in front of the finished product. Below, pictured from left, Barry, designers Robert Warner and Benjamin Decker, artist Brad White, Heather Wirtz, Gail DeGood-Guy, Kelly Jerew, Scott Jerew and Chad Hoffman.
